< img src = "/uploads/blogs/6a/25/IB-FQN17ik73_9862978a.jpg" Alt = "Administrator Telegram-channel, who told about Kharkiv shopping center, received 5 years conditionally"/~ 62 < p > The administrator of the Telegram-channel, who spoke about the work of the Tax Code in Novobavarsky and Shevchenkivsky districts of Kharkiv, received 5 years conventionally. The sentence of the October District Court of Kharkiv dated February 26 & nbsp; placed & nbsp; in the Unified Register of Judgments.

~ < P > Investigators proved that the channel was created on December 17, 2024. According to the investigation, the administrator indicated the addresses for which the servicemen were in the course of conscription of Ukrainian citizens for military service. The court decided that he was assisting persons who evade military accounting or otherwise violate the rules of military accounting, avoid receiving narratives.

< P > The administrator was found guilty of obstruction of the Armed Forces. He was sentenced & ndash; 5 years of imprisonment. Sentenced Released from serving a sentence with a pass for two years.

< p > in Ukraine all men aged 18 to 60 should be on military accounting, they can be attached to the Armed Forces.
